Dear Gurus, My name is Rongdian Lu with CA. On Suse SLES 8, we found that a problem with "who": If a user logged on thru console and open several terminal sessions, = both "w" and "who" list all session users, however, when we closed the = terminals other than the logon window, who still lists the entries, but = "w" delisted them, which is right. I found that utmp can detect if the terminal is closed or not either.=20 So could you guys tell me how "w" is written?=20 thanks, Ron=20
